首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Mysql如何随机获取数呢rand()

words,按照主键顺序取出word值,使用rand()让每一个word生成一个大于0小于1小数,并把这个小数word放入到临时R,W,到此扫描行数是10000....现在临时有10000行数据了,接下来你要在这个没有索引内存临时上,按照R字段排序 初始化sort_buffer两个字段,一个是double,一个整形 内存临时中一行一行获取R位置信息,把字段放入到...而优先级算法,可以精准获取最小三个word 临时获取前三行,组成一个最大堆 然后拿下一行数据,最大堆R比较,大于R,则丢弃,小于R,则替换 重复2步骤,直到把10000行数据循环完成...随机排序方法 我们简化一下问题,只需要获取一个随机字段,我们思路如下 获取主键id最大值,最小值 然后根据最大值最小值,算出x=(M-N)*rand() + N; 再获取不小于X第一行...select * from t where id >= @X limit 1; 虽然上面可以获取一个数,但是他并不是一个随机数,因为如何id可能存在空洞,导致每一行获取概率并不一样,如id=1,2,4,5

4.5K20

如何使用DNSSQLi数据库获取数据样本

泄露数据方法有许多,但你是否知道可以使用DNSSQLi数据库获取数据样本?本文我将为大家介绍一些利用SQL盲注DB服务器枚举泄露数据技术。...我尝试使用SQLmap进行一些额外枚举泄露,但由于SQLmap header原因WAF阻止了我请求。我需要另一种方法来验证SQLi并显示可以服务器恢复数据。 ?...在之前文章,我向大家展示了如何使用xp_dirtree通过SQLi来捕获SQL Server用户哈希值方法。这里我尝试了相同方法,但由于客户端防火墙上出站过滤而失败了。...在下面的示例,红框查询语句将会为我们Northwind数据库返回名。 ? 在该查询你应该已经注意到了有2个SELECT语句。...这样一来查询结果将只会为我们返回名列表第10个结果。 ? 知道了这一点后,我们就可以使用Intruder迭代所有可能名,只需修改第二个SELECT语句并增加每个请求结果数即可。 ?

11.5K10

教你如何快速 Oracle 官方文档获取需要知识

11G 官方文档:https://docs.oracle.com/cd/E11882_01/server.112/e40402/toc.htm 这里以 11g R2 官方文档为例: 今天来说说怎么快速官方文档得到自己需要知识...各种管理、索引、空间、 redo等都可以在这里找到(在线传输空间也在此文档中有描述) Performance tuning guide ,里面包含优化相关内容,介绍了优化方法、数据库实例以及...具体还没深入了解,但是感觉还是比较先进好用,当 plsql没有办法完成任务时候,可以使用 java存储过程来解决,比如说想要获取主机目录下文件列表。...有兴趣也可以看看。 Data Warehousing and Business Intelligence 页面: 数据仓库商业智能相关技术。...Text Application Developer’s Guide Text Reference,全文索引相关东西了。

7.7K00

Excel技术:如何在一个工作筛选并获取另一工作数据

为简化起见,我们使用少量数据来进行演示,示例数据如下图1所示。 图1 示例数据位于名为“1”,我们想获取“产地”列为“宜昌”数据。...方法1:使用Power Query 在新工作簿,单击功能区“数据”选项卡获取数据——来自文件——工作簿”命令,找到“1”所在工作簿,单击“导入”,在弹出导航器中选择工作簿文件1”...单击功能区新出现“查询”选项卡“编辑”命令,打开Power Query编辑器,在“产地”列,选取“宜昌”,如下图2所示。 图2 单击“确定”。...然而,单击Power Query编辑器“关闭并上载”命令,结果如下图3所示。...图3 方法2:使用FILTER函数 新建一个工作,在合适位置输入公式: =FILTER(1,1[产地]="宜昌") 结果如下图4所示。

9.7K40

如何在onCreate获取View高度宽度

如何在onCreate获取View高度宽度 在开发过程中经常需要获取到View宽和高,可以通过View.getWidth()View.getHeight()来得到宽高。...然而新手们经常在onCreate方法中直接调用上面两个方法得到值是0! 这是为什么呢? 因为View绘制是通过两个遍历来完成,一个measure过程,一个layout过程。...只有经过“测量”“布局”之后,View才能正确地完成绘制。而这一切是发生在onCreate方法之后。...所以在onCreate中直接使用View.getWidth()View.getHeight()是无法得到正确。 那应该怎么onCreate获取View宽高呢?...开发者可以通过View.post()方法来获取到View宽高,该方法传递一个Runnable参数,然后将其添加到消息队列,最后在UI线程执行。

5.3K20

一晚上累计 292 万人紧盯 Flightradar24 网站,航班跟踪技术原理是什么?

2航班跟踪工作原理 Flightradar24 结合了来自多个数据数据,包括 ADS-B、MLAT 雷达数据。...ADS-B、MLAT 雷达数据与航空公司机场时刻航班状态数据汇总在一起,可以在 Flightradar24 官网(www.flightradar24.com)应用程序(https://www.flightradar24...1、飞机 GPS 导航(卫星)获取其位置 2、飞机上 ADS-B 应答器传输包含位置(以及更多内容)信号 3、ADS-B 信号由连接到 Flightradar24 接收器接收 4、接收器向 Flightradar24...估计 当一架飞机飞出覆盖范围时,如果航班目的地已知,Flightradar24 会持续估计飞机位置长达 2 小时。对于没有已知目的地飞机,位置估计可达 10 分钟。...单击左侧面板 index.html,查看应用程序代码。 将 your_token_here 替换为我们令牌页面处获取访问令牌。

1.6K10

Linuxuname命令:获取系统内核操作系统相关信息

在Linux操作系统,uname命令是一个常用命令行工具,用于获取系统内核操作系统相关信息。通过使用uname命令,您可以查看检查Linux系统各种属性特征。...适用场景uname命令在Linux系统管理维护具有广泛应用场景,包括但不限于以下几个方面:系统识别版本检查:通过使用uname命令,您可以快速获取系统内核名称、版本操作系统名称。...故障排除问题诊断:在故障排除过程,了解系统内核版本硬件架构等信息对于定位问题调试非常有帮助。uname命令可以提供这些关键信息,以便您能够更准确地定位和解决问题。...系统监控报告:在系统监控性能分析,uname命令可用于生成系统报告记录。您可以将uname命令输出与其他监控工具结合使用,以获取更全面的系统状态信息。...总结uname命令是Linux系统中一个非常有用工具,用于获取系统内核操作系统相关信息。通过使用不同选项,您可以获取内核名称、主机名、内核版本、硬件架构操作系统名称等信息。

35300

Superset BI 数据可视化分析之超详细上手教程

关键概念,该数据集包含一个英国组织员工在2011年飞行。...每趟航班信息如下: 旅客部门。在本教程,部门已重命名为“橙色”,“黄色”“紫色”。 机票费用。 旅游舱(经济舱,高级经济舱,商务舱和头等舱)。 票是单程票还是来回票。 旅行日期。...有关始发地目的地信息。 起点终点之间距离,以公里(km)为单位。 启用上传 CSV 功能 编辑 Databases 列表 examples 数据库记录: ?...最后单击底部 保存 按钮。 ? Table(表格可视化) 显示航班数量每个旅行舱位费用。 创建一个 Chart ? 选择数据 tutorial_flights ?...Filter box(筛选盒) 我们将创建一个过滤器,它允许我们查看那些特定国家出发航班。 ? 保存图表 ? 发布面板 ?

10.3K32

一夜成名航班追踪网站,什么来头?

根据官网信息,Fligtradar24 结合了多种数据,包括 ADS-B、MLAT、雷达数据,以及航空公司机场时刻航班状态信息等。 ADS-B ADS-B,即广播式自动相关监控。...Flightradar24 网站 App 实际上,不仅是对地面的空管 Flightradar24 这种追踪网站有用,ADS-B 也给机上飞行员提供了便利。...除了以上提到两种数据,Flightradar24 数据还包括卫星数据、北美雷达数据,开放式滑翔机网络(OGN)北美实时数据等。 对了,Flightradar24 还有不少好玩小功能。...除此之外,还有粉丝帮他们写了一个可以 ADS-B 信号获取各种信息软件。...可以看到,在 Flightradar24 官网上会显示航班始发地、目的地、呼号、位置、高度、空速航向,甚至连飞机驾驶仪表设置、剩余油量等数据都能提供。

53720

一夜成名航班追踪网站,什么来头?

根据官网信息,Fligtradar24结合了多种数据,包括ADS-B、MLAT、雷达数据,以及航空公司机场时刻航班状态信息等。 ADS-B ADS-B,即广播式自动相关监控。...Flightradar24网站App 实际上,不仅是对地面的空管Flightradar24这种追踪网站有用,ADS-B也给机上飞行员提供了便利。...除了以上提到两种数据,Flightradar24数据还包括卫星数据、北美雷达数据,开放式滑翔机网络(OGN)北美实时数据等。 对了,Flightradar24还有不少好玩小功能。...除此之外,还有粉丝帮他们写了一个可以ADS-B信号获取各种信息软件。...可以看到,在Flightradar24官网上会显示航班始发地、目的地、呼号、位置、高度、空速航向,甚至连飞机驾驶仪表设置、剩余油量等数据都能提供。

28310

一夜成名航班追踪网站,什么来头?

根据官网信息,Fligtradar24结合了多种数据,包括ADS-B、MLAT、雷达数据,以及航空公司机场时刻航班状态信息等。 ADS-B ADS-B,即广播式自动相关监控。...Flightradar24网站App 实际上,不仅是对地面的空管Flightradar24这种追踪网站有用,ADS-B也给机上飞行员提供了便利。...除了以上提到两种数据,Flightradar24数据还包括卫星数据、北美雷达数据,开放式滑翔机网络(OGN)北美实时数据等。 对了,Flightradar24还有不少好玩小功能。...除此之外,还有粉丝帮他们写了一个可以ADS-B信号获取各种信息软件。...可以看到,在Flightradar24官网上会显示航班始发地、目的地、呼号、位置、高度、空速航向,甚至连飞机驾驶仪表设置、剩余油量等数据都能提供。

28420

Elasticsearch 之聚合分析入门

本文主要介绍 Elasticsearch 聚合功能,介绍什么是 Bucket Metric 聚合,以及如何实现嵌套聚合。...首先举一个生活例子,这个是京东搜索界面,在搜索框输入“华为”进行搜索,就会得到如上界面,搜索框就是我们常用搜索功能,而下面这些,比如分类、热点、操作系统、CPU 类型等是根据 ES 聚合分析获得相关结果...结果可以看到文档根据目的地分成了不同桶,每个桶还包括 doc_count,这样就可以很轻松知道 ES 存储航班信息,去往意大利、美国、中国等国家分别有多少架航班。...结果可以看出,飞往意大利航班一共有 2371 架,其中机票最高价格为 1195 元,最低价格为 100 元,平均价格为 586 元,很快就可以得到统计一些结果。...通过这个请求不但可以获取航班目的地统计信息,还可以得到航班抵达时天气状况,运行结果如下所示: ?

1.1K20
领券